2. Pain Alleviation
Cold laser therapy, also known as low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a discomfort administration treatment that promotes the body's all-natural healing procedures. Its noninvasive process prevents inflammation, decreasing swelling and increasing the development of new cells.

Throughout a session, the medical professional or professional will hold a device over an area of your body, such as your knee. It will either touch your skin or be very close to it, enabling the laser light to permeate deep right into the impacted cells.

The light energy promotes your body to generate nitric oxide, which opens up capillary and lowers the development of edema. This permits the oxygen and nutrients to obtain where they're laser center required, aiding you recover. Because of this, lots of individuals experience a reduction in pain as soon as their initial session.

5. Overall Health
Cold Laser Therapy is an increasingly popular alternative treatment for pain and inflammation. Developed by an osteopath (a doctor who specializes in treating the bones and joints of the body), this treatment involves the use of non-thermal laser diodes to promote tissue repair and accelerate healing. The procedure is performed at a medical professional's office or in-home with a handheld device, and can be used to treat a variety of conditions.

The device is small and handheld, similar to a flashlight, and emits low-level laser energy that stimulates cells to produce more ATP, accelerating the body's natural healing process. This treatment is safe, noninvasive and drug-free. The FDA has approved its use for numerous conditions, including arthritis, carpal tunnel, bursitis and sprains/strains.
